负载均衡方法多样,包括轮询、最少连接、IP哈希等。本文全面解析多种高效策略,揭秘负载均衡的多样化方法,帮助您了解如何实现网络资源的合理分配。
本文目录导读:
随着互联网技术的飞速发展,企业对于服务器性能的要求越来越高,负载均衡作为一种优化服务器性能、提高系统稳定性的技术,越来越受到关注,本文将全面解析负载均衡的多样化方法,帮助读者了解并选择适合自己的负载均衡策略。
图片来源于网络,如有侵权联系删除
负载均衡概述
负载均衡(Load Balancing)是一种将多个请求分发到多个服务器上的技术,以达到提高系统吞吐量、降低响应时间、增强系统稳定性的目的,根据负载均衡的实现方式,可以分为以下几种类型:
1、硬件负载均衡
2、软件负载均衡
3、云负载均衡
4、无状态负载均衡
5、有状态负载均衡
硬件负载均衡
硬件负载均衡器是一种物理设备,具有高性能、高可靠性等特点,它通过智能算法,将请求分发到不同的服务器上,从而实现负载均衡,硬件负载均衡器主要分为以下几种:
1、网络交换机
2、路由器
3、硬件负载均衡器
软件负载均衡
软件负载均衡是通过在服务器上安装负载均衡软件来实现的一种负载均衡方式,与硬件负载均衡相比,软件负载均衡具有以下优点:
1、成本低
2、灵活性高
3、可扩展性强
图片来源于网络,如有侵权联系删除
常见的软件负载均衡软件有:
1、Nginx
2、Apache
3、HAProxy
4、LVS
5、F5 BIG-IP
云负载均衡
云负载均衡是利用云计算技术实现的一种负载均衡方式,它具有以下特点:
1、弹性伸缩
2、高可用性
3、低成本
常见的云负载均衡服务有:
1、AWS ELB
2、阿里云SLB
3、腾讯云CLB
图片来源于网络,如有侵权联系删除
4、华为云ELB
无状态负载均衡
无状态负载均衡是指服务器之间没有状态信息,每个请求都是独立的,这种方式适用于Web服务器、文件服务器等场景,常见的无状态负载均衡算法有:
1、轮询(Round Robin)
2、随机(Random)
3、最少连接(Least Connections)
4、基于源IP的哈希(Source IP Hash)
有状态负载均衡
有状态负载均衡是指服务器之间保存有状态信息,如会话信息、用户信息等,这种方式适用于需要会话保持的场景,如电子商务、在线游戏等,常见的有状态负载均衡算法有:
1、会话保持(Session Persistence)
2、基于源IP的哈希(Source IP Hash)
3、基于用户名的哈希(User Name Hash)
负载均衡技术是实现高性能、高可用性系统的重要手段,本文从硬件、软件、云负载均衡等多个方面,全面解析了负载均衡的多样化方法,企业在选择负载均衡策略时,应根据自身需求、成本等因素进行综合考虑,以实现最优的负载均衡效果。
评论列表